Genesis 46:2 - Israel
Verse | Strongs No. | Hebrew | |
---|---|---|---|
And God | H430 | אֱלֹהִים |
[Noun Masculine] g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ural {thus} espec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ative |
spake | H559 | אָמַר |
[Verb] to say (used with great latitude) |
unto Israel | H3478 | יִשְׂרָאֵל |
[Proper Name Masculine] he will rule as God; {Jisrael} a symbolical name of Jacob; also (typically) of his posterity |
in the visions | H4759 | מַרְאָה |
[Noun Feminine] a vision; also (causatively) a mirror |
of the night | H3915 | לַיִל |
[Noun Masculine] properly a twist (away of the {light}) that {is} night; figuratively adversity |
and said | H559 | אָמַר |
[Verb] to say (used with great latitude) |
Jacob | H3290 | יַעֲקֹב |
[Proper Name Masculine] heel catcher (that {is} supplanter); {Jaakob} the Israelitish patriarch |
